Incorporated on 8 October 2025, Margaret House (Hertfordshire) Limited has one registered activity: residential care for elderly and disabled people. Its registered address sits on Portmill Lane in Hitchin, a town-centre street that typically houses accountants and registered-office services rather than care settings, so the site of any home the company runs is not disclosed in the public record. The name itself suggests a single named home, and the county suffix implies the operator wants it distinguished from other Margaret House services elsewhere. That is inference. The filings show one company, one address, one SIC code. The company holds a Skilled Worker sponsor licence with an A rating, which allows it to sponsor overseas nationals for eligible roles. A care provider of this size would most commonly use that licence for senior care assistants, team leaders and registered nurses, since those roles generally meet the skill and salary thresholds on the route. Front-line care assistant work is not normally sponsorable. A licence granted within months of incorporation suggests the operator anticipated difficulty filling posts locally, a familiar problem across Hertfordshire's care sector. Beyond that there is little to examine, as no accounts or employee figures are on file yet. Anyone applying should ask about the home's Care Quality Commission registration and inspection rating, and confirm which role the sponsor would actually certify.
